2005 Haut Medoc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ot, Cabernet Franc
Chateau D'Arvigny 2005 is a captivating red wine from the esteemed Haut-Médoc region, renowned for its splendid terroir and meticulous winemaking practices. This blend of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ot, and Cabernet Franc showcases an elegant medium body with a well-balanced structure. The acidity is bright and refreshing, enhancing the wine's overall profile. Savory tannins provide a firm backbone yet remain approachable, allowing for a delightful experience. The fruit intensity is prominent, revealing layers of dark berries and plum, complemented by subtle notes of cedar and spice. This wine is dry, making it a fantastic pairing for a range of hearty dishes. With its enduring finish, Chateau D'Arvigny reflects the dedication of its vintners and the unique characteristics of its region.
